Eggplant or aubergine is a plant species grown worldwide for its edible fruit. Although often considered a vegetable, by definition it is a berry with edible skin.

Aubergines are a good source of vitamins B1 and B6. Vitamin B1, also called thiamine, helps the body turn food into energy and keep our nervous system healthy; Our bodies can't make vitamin B1 themselves so it is important to absorb it via food source.

Available all year round, yet they're at their best from July to September.

Aubergine nutritional benefit:

Aubergines contain nasunin, a protective compounds with antioxidant properties that may reduce the breakdown of fats in the brain ( a process that can cause cell damage). Eggplant also contain anthocyanins which help preventing neuro-inflammation and facilitate blood flow to the brain; This could help prevent memory loss.
